California Meal Break Law Requirements
If you work over 5 hours in a day, you are entitled to a meal break of at least 30 minutes that must start before the end of the fifth hour of your shift.

Definition of Full-Time Employee
For purposes of the employer shared responsibility provisions, a full-time employee is, for a calendar month, an employee employed on average at least 30 hours of service per week, or 130 hours of service per month.

The Real Living Wage Foundation has today (22 September 2022) announced the new hourly rates for the Real Living Wage. Across the UK the rate will be £10.90, a £1.00 rise, and £11.95 in London, an uplift of 90p.
In most jobs, you can't normally be asked to work between 10pm and 6am. If your contract says you have to work until 11pm, that's alright but you shouldn't start work before 7am the next morning. You can be asked to work at other times in exceptional circumstances.

Rest breaks if you're over school leaving age but under 18
You're usually entitled to: a 30 minute rest break if you work for more than 4 hours and 30 minutes in a day. 12 hours rest between each working day. 2 rest days per week.

Previous rate | Rate from April 2022 | Increase |
---|---|---|
National living wage | £8.91 | £9.50 |
21-22-year-old rate | £8.36 | £9.18 |
18-20-year-old rate | £6.56 | £6.83 |
16-17-year-old rate | £4.62 | £4.81 |
